Subject: Re: [PATCH bpf-next v4 0/4] Hash support for sock

From: John Fastabend <john.fastabend@...il.com>
Date: Thu,  3 May 2018 11:28:24 -0700

> In the original sockmap implementation we got away with using an
> array similar to devmap. However, unlike devmap where an ifindex
> has a nice 1:1 function into the map we have found some use cases
> with sockets that need to be referenced using longer keys.
> 
> This series adds support for a sockhash map reusing as much of
> the sockmap code as possible. I made the decision to add sockhash
> specific helpers vs trying to generalize the existing helpers
> because (a) they have sockmap in the name and (b) the keys are
> different types. I prefer to be explicit here rather than play
> type games or do something else tricky.
> 
> To test this we duplicate all the sockmap testing except swap out
> the sockmap with a sockhash.
